The 2024 DHS Commencement is scheduled for tonight at 8 PM at Leopard Stadium. Gates will open at 6 PM. Balloons will not be allowed to enter the stadium until after the ceremony. This is so that all spectators have a clear line of sight to the graduates and to avoid any safety hazards. Family members are welcome to bring in balloons once the ceremony has concluded. Please stay off the field turf during the ceremony. Lawn Chairs will be allowed on the track but must be kept away from the turf so the graduates have enough room to walk by. Ceremony Conclusion: Please remain off the field until the graduates have finished walking to the south end of the field in front of the video board. This is for the safety of all graduates and their families. Once the graduates have finished their walk, the field will be open for families to find their graduates, celebrate, and take family photos. This procedure will prevent a bottleneck of graduates and spectators in the stadium's north end and allow everyone enough space to move freely. Regarding Stole/Cords: Graduates can only wear stoles and cords issued by DHS, UAC, or the military. We encourage parents and family to keep all other stoles in their possession until after the ceremony. Please use a poncho if needed. No umbrellas please. Graduates can pick up their official diplomas at the DHS office on Tuesday, May 14th.
